Python基础题,求解。

11,求100-400以内能被3整除,又能被7整除的数。

 

12,输出100以内能被6整除的数,并求和。

 

13,输出所有水仙花数。

 

14,求100以内偶数的和。

 

15,求100以内奇数的平方和。

 

16,在120-220之间查找第一个能被11整除的数。

 

17,求100以内能被5整除的数立方和的平均值。

18,求100以内能被7整除的数的个数。

19,输出10以下的正整数,但不输出数字5。

20,求200以内前8个能被9整除的数,并求和。

 


#11
for i in range(100,401):
    if i%3==0 and i%7==0:
        print(i)

#12
num=0
for  i in range(1,100):
    if i%6==0:
       num+=i
print(num)

#14
num=0
for i in range(1,100):
    if i%2==0:
        num+=i
print(num)

#15
for i in range(1,100):
    if i%2!=0:
        print(i**2)#求100以内每个奇数的平方和
        num+=i**2
print(num)#100以内全部奇数的总和

#16
br=False
num=0
while br==True:
    for i in range(120,221):
        if i%11==0:
            br=True
            num=i
print(num)

#17
num=0
zhi=0
for i in range(1,100):
    if i%5==0:
        num+=i**3
        zhi+=1
print(num/zhi)

#18
num=0
for i in range(1,100):
    if i%7==0:
        num+=1
print(num)

#19
l=[i for i in range(1,10) if i!=5]
for i in l:
    print(i)
    
#20
num=8
zh=0
shu=0
while num!=0:
    shu+=1
    if shu%9==0:
        num-=1
        zh+=shu
        print("1",num,shu)
    print("2")
print(zh)#总和

合着你是把整张卷子都发上来了吧